The Vestibular Disorders Association (VEDA) is hosting their first ever Virtual Vestibular Conference! Dr. Danielle Tate, PT and Dr. Abbie Ross, PT, NCS are your hosts/moderators for the week. Today's talk was about Persistent Postural Perceptual Dizziness (PPPD) and was presented by Dr. Janene Holmberg PT, DPT, NCS.
Persistent Postural Perceptual Dizziness (PPPD) is being increasingly used to explain vestibular symptoms without an obvious cause. Many patients are confused about this diagnosis – is it a physiological or psychological condition? Will I ever get better? In the session we touched on some things to help you better understand what PPPD is and isn't, how it is diagnosed and treated, and what outcomes you can expect from treatment.
